Abstract

The utility model provides a cage inner sphere surface diameter measuring instrument apparatus. The apparatus comprises a pedestal. One side of the pedestal is provided with a left support plate and the other side is provided with a right support plate. A positioning plate is arranged in the middle of the left support plate and the right support plate. A supporting plate is arranged below the positioning plate. A measuring block is connected below the supporting plate. A measuring head is arranged above the measuring block. A measuring display apparatus is connected to the measuring block. The cage is placed in the positioning plate. A rotation handle is used to adjust the measuring head to be contacted with the inner sphere surface of the cage. A horizontal measuring instrument is arranged above the pedestal. Through a pointer on a round handle, a horizontal condition of the cage which is placed in the positioning plate is measured. The round handle can adjust a horizontal position of the cage. A fixed pin is arranged and can be used for fixing the positioning plate. A testes result is displayed on the measuring display apparatus. By using the apparatus of the utility model, the structure is simple; operation is convenient; test precision is high and production cost is low.
